    Here's what I found for ya............seems as though everyone else is on the water catchin all the DANG FISH! I'm sure there are easier ways to get there, but this is what ol Mapquest showed.

    -Start out going NORTH on OSAGE BLUFF RD toward PARK RD.
    -Turn RIGHT to stay on OSAGE BLUFF RD.
    -Turn LEFT onto MO-83.
    -Turn LEFT onto MO-83/MO-MM.
    -Turn LEFT onto BLUE BRANCH RD/MO-83.
    -Merge onto US-65 N/MO-7 N.
    -Take the ramp toward WARSAW.
    -Turn LEFT onto MO-7. 17.8 mi
    -Turn LEFT onto SE HIGHWAY U.
    -Turn LEFT onto SE 803RD RD.
    -RR 3.
